What is Red Light Therapy?

Red light therapy (RLT) utilizes low-level light wavelengths to treat various health problems. Initially developed by NASA to grow plants in space, the technology soon found applications in medical and therapeutic fields. The treatment includes shining red light from a device onto the skin, reaching the tissues without causing any damage. Many people have started to explore options for red light therapy at home, making it a convenient and accessible option for regular use.

Red light therapy is often called Low-Level Laser Therapy (LLLT) or photobiomodulation. Its popularity has grown because of its possible benefits in handling various health problems.

How Does Red Light Therapy Work?

Red light therapy functions by reaching a depth of approximately 8 to 10 millimeters into the skin, impacting cells on a molecular level. When red light hits the skin, it stimulates the mitochondria, often called the powerhouses of cells. This activation produces adenosine triphosphate (ATP), the cellular energy source necessary for cell repair and regeneration. The increased ATP production enhances the cellular processes involved in healing and rejuvenation. Red light therapy improves blood circulation to injured tissues, assisting in delivering oxygen and nutrients, consequently expediting the healing procedure. This mechanism makes red light therapy effective in treating various skin conditions, promoting wound healing, and reducing pain and inflammation.

What To Expect During a Session

A typical red light therapy session lasts between 10 and 20 minutes. It is painless, and many people find it relaxing. During the session, you will either stand or sit in front of a red light therapy device, which emits wavelengths of red light directly onto your skin. Protective eyewear is often provided to shield your eyes from the light, ensuring safety throughout the session. The red light may feel warm on your skin, but it is not uncomfortable. Most people start to notice improvements in their symptoms after a few sessions. The number of sessions needed depends on the specific condition being addressed and how each person responds to the treatment.

Potential Side Effects and Precautions

Overall, red light therapy is typically considered safe, with limited potential for side effects. Some people may experience minor eye discomfort if they do not wear protective eyewear during sessions. A slight increase in body temperature is also possible due to enhanced blood circulation. However, these side effects are usually mild and temporary. It is crucial to follow the manufacturer’s guidelines and consult a healthcare provider to ensure red light therapy suits your specific needs. People with specific medical conditions or taking photosensitive medications should be careful and consult a doctor before beginning red light therapy.

Understanding Upright MRI

Unlike conventional MRI machines, upright MRI systems allow patients to be imaged in various positions—such as sitting or standing—allowing specialists to see how gravity impacts the brain or spinal structures. Most notably, doctors can observe the spine’s natural alignment or changes in the brain that occur only when a person is upright. This innovation is particularly significant in diagnosing spinal conditions, brain abnormalities, or dynamic disorders that may not manifest when the patient lies flat.

Advantages of Upright MRI in Brain Imaging

  • Natural Positioning: Upright MRI aligns closely with real-life conditions, potentially revealing abnormalities not seen during traditional, supine imaging. For instance, positional influences on cerebral spinal fluid and vascular flow become apparent only when upright.
  • Patient Comfort: Upright MRI’s open design minimizes feelings of confinement, which benefits patients with anxiety or claustrophobia during scans and enhances the overall healthcare experience.
  • Dynamic Imaging: Some neurological and orthopedic symptoms only occur when the patient is upright or in motion. Upright MRI enables imaging during specific postures or simple movements for more dynamic, functional assessments, and is instrumental in diagnosing Chiari malformation and similar disorders.

Clinical Applications of Upright MRI

  • Spinal Disorders: Upright MRI is invaluable for assessing herniated discs, spinal stenosis, and alignment issues that only manifest under weight-bearing conditions.
  • Neurological Conditions: Imaging performed in non-supine positions can better diagnose and monitor conditions like Chiari malformation, normal pressure hydrocephalus, and other cerebrospinal fluid disorders.
  • Orthopedic Assessments: Upright MRI reveals joint function, stability, and alignment during real-world movement, informing treatment plans for orthopedic and sports medicine cases.

Challenges and Considerations

  • Cost and Accessibility: While upright MRI offers unique diagnostic benefits, the technology can be more expensive than traditional scans and unavailable everywhere.
  • Image Quality: Historically, Upright machines delivered slightly lower image resolution than their horizontal counterparts, though the gap is narrowing with new technology.
  • Patient Positioning: Proper positioning and patient cooperation are critical to ensuring the accuracy of scans, requiring skill and experience among technicians and radiologists.

Chamomile: A Soothing Ally

Chamomile (Matricaria chamomilla) stands out as a gentle remedy for relaxation and improved sleep. Its signature daisy-like flowers are rich in apigenin, a flavonoid that binds to brain receptors associated with tranquility and stress reduction. People often enjoy chamomile as a nighttime tea that soothes frazzled nerves, but it can also ease mild digestive complaints such as indigestion and bloating. Those sensitive to ragweed should use chamomile with caution due to the possibility of allergic reactions.

Ginger: Digestive and Anti-Inflammatory Support

Ginger (Zingiber officinale) is prized for its spicy flavor and supportive effects on digestion. Its main active constituent, gingerol, has demonstrated clear anti-inflammatory and anti-nausea properties in clinical research. Sipping ginger tea or adding freshly grated ginger to meals can help calm an upset stomach, combat mild inflammation, and even aid in managing symptoms of colds and sore throats. To maximize these benefits, pair ginger with warm water and lemon or blend it in smoothies.

Echinacea: Immune System Booster

Echinacea (Echinacea purpurea) is a popular go-to for those fending off seasonal colds and flus. Its immune-boosting power comes from supporting the activity of white blood cells, which play a critical role in the body’s defense against infections. Many people take echinacea at the first sign of cold symptoms, choosing either teas, tinctures, or capsules. While some studies are mixed, several suggest echinacea can reduce cold duration and severity when taken early.

Peppermint: Relief for Digestive Discomfort

Peppermint (Mentha piperita) delivers a cooling, refreshing taste as well as tangible digestive benefits. The menthol it contains relaxes the muscles of the digestive tract, making peppermint tea or capsules effective for relieving bloating, indigestion, and even symptoms of irritable bowel syndrome (IBS). Topical peppermint oil should always be diluted before use. However, a warm cup of peppermint tea after meals is a gentle way to promote smoother digestion and ease digestive discomfort.

Valerian: Natural Sleep Aid

Long celebrated as a gentle sedative, valerian root (Valeriana officinalis) naturally encourages better sleep and reduced anxiety. Its unique compounds boost the levels of gamma-aminobutyric acid (GABA) in the brain—the chemical responsible for slowing nervous system activity and inducing a sense of calm. While the flavor of valerian tea can be strong and earthy, its use before bed has helped many achieve a more restful night with fewer interruptions. Use valerian with caution when combined with other sedatives or sleep aids.

Dandelion: Liver Health and Detoxification

Dandelion (Taraxacum officinale), often mistaken for a mere lawn weed, is remarkably nutritious. It’s loaded with antioxidants and compounds such as inulin, which promote healthy digestion and act as a prebiotic for gut flora. Dandelion tea is popular for supporting liver function and aiding natural detoxification processes. There’s even research suggesting dandelion may help regulate blood sugar and reduce inflammation. All parts of the plant—roots, leaves, and flowers—can be used in herbal preparations.

Yarrow: Wound Healing and Menstrual Relief

Yarrow (Achillea millefolium) is named for Achilles, the ancient hero who reportedly used it to heal wounds. Today, yarrow is best known for its antiseptic and anti-inflammatory properties, making it useful for treating scrapes and promoting skin healing when applied topically as a wash or salve. Yarrow tea has also been used to alleviate menstrual discomfort and heavy bleeding, although individuals with allergies to other members of the daisy family should use it with caution.
